    The 3DO is well worth picking up espicially for the price its going for now. There are a lot of games that were very inovative for the system as well as some real junk.(I totally agree about Shadow War os Succesion as this was an abismal game). One of the things i like was the way the controllers daisey chained off each other. I paid $350 for mine when it was selling for $600 from a distributer i knew and the thought of some of my friends yanking my system on the floor(my friends were active type of players who would slam back real quick in the sofa) this way they were plugged into my controller protecing my 3DO.Some of the games that were made for the system were made by people making games for the new systems today. One of the biggest names I can think of is Naughty Dog. They made the game Way Of The Warrior which was a Mortal Kombat rip off some say buy was actually a lot of fun and had a ton of hidden stuff on the disc(some of which will porbaly never be found) and it had probaly the best sound trak for a game ( White Zombie).Anyway here is a small list of games to get if you are interested.

    Alone in the dark - At the time was a great game as it was probaly the first Resident Evil style game ( very slow and awkward)

    Crash and Burn - Which was a pack in racing combat game(bad acting but fun to play)

    Escape From Monster Manor - FPS as Doom was all the rage at the time.

    Fifa Soccer - Was a great game but i wasnt into soccer.

    Madden Football - This game was the best version of Madden until PS2 as far as i was concerned

    Need For Speed - This game was awesome as it was more of a driving simulator than a racing game. ( exterior veiw did not handle as good as inside the car view.

    Road Rash - Agree with earlier post was best version and darn near close to best game for the system.

    AD&D - Both were very good games ( Slayer and Death Keep)

    Rteurn Fire $ RF Maps Of Death - Were a capture the flag style game but a lot of fun with a classical soundtrak.

    Samurai Showdown - Was probably the best version for consoles besides the NEO GEO version( 3DO's version did nat have scaling)

    Twisted: The Game Show - Was not a great game but was a decent party game as the charecters and commercials were pretty funny to watch.

    Space Hulk: Vengeance of the Blood Angels - This was a strategy game as you command a squad of marines with differant capablilities.

    well anyway thats a few games if you have any doubts there are web sites with reviews and pictures to let you know which games to stay away from. The adult titles were bad as posted above. Most were just grainy video clips of porn movies or just God awefull games wrapped around the fact that they had nudity with almost no real gameplay at all.
    But the system is well worth picking up as i still play mine frequently. Have fun .[/list]

    Re: Quarantine. I don't think the game is horrible but it's not great either. You'll usually find it on a top ten disappointment list for 3DO owners, if not a top ten worst list! Still, like I said...

    Re: Adult titles: The US has a bunch of titles from Vivid (yes, the same as the porn produciton company), though only one of these, "Mind Teazzer", is actually a game - and not a bad one. The only other US-released adult GAME is Neurodancer, a sort-of first-person-maze-hunt where you ultimately pay to have a stripper do her thing. There are a number of import adult titles, like Penthouse Interactive, The Virtual Cameraman series, Nice Body Interactive, and more. They're particularly difficult to find but "findable".
